Au Gold files NI 43-101 report for Havelock

AUGC · Price
Executive Summary
- Au Gold Corp. filed an NI 43-101 technical report and announced conditional TSX Venture Exchange approval for the 100% acquisition of the 11,663-hectare Havelock gold-antimony project in Victoria, Australia, from Leviathan Gold Australia.
- Initial rock sampling conducted during the technical report preparation returned assays up to 12.20 g/t gold and 0.18% antimony, with the company planning follow-up exploration once the acquisition closes.
- The company engaged two investor relations firms to handle communications and market research, with combined monthly fees under $5,000.
Key Details
- Acquisition Target: 100% interest in the 11,663-hectare Havelock gold-antimony project, situated in the Victorian goldfields between Bendigo and Ballarat, Australia.
- Counterparty: Leviathan Gold Australia, a wholly owned subsidiary of Leviathan Metals Corp.
- Regulatory Status & Timeline: Received conditional approval from the TSX Venture Exchange; expected closing on or around March 4, 2026.
- Technical Report: NI 43-101 compliant report filed on SEDAR+ in connection with the acquisition.
- Rock Sample Assays: Seven select rock samples collected along the northern half of the Shaw-McFarlane trend and west of historic workings returned gold values ranging from below detection to 12.20 g/t Au.
- Highlight Sample: A milky white quartz float with disseminated stibnite and phyllically altered sediment selvages returned 12.20 g/t gold and 0.18% antimony, located approximately 1,300 metres northwest of the historic McFarlane shaft.
- IR Contract 1 (David Jan Consulting): Retained for investor relations services on an hourly, month-to-month basis. Contract dated Feb. 24, 2026. Monthly invoicing anticipated to be <$3,000. Consultant is arm's length, holds no current interest, and is eligible for stock options per TSXV policies.
- IR Contract 2 (Northern Venture Group Inc.): Retained for investor relations, market research, and digital marketing. Six-month term expiring July 31, 2026, with a monthly fee of $2,000. Contract dated Jan. 27, 2026, subject to TSXV approval. Principal Richard Mills and the firm are arm's length and own <2% of issued share capital.
- Qualified Person: William Wengzynowski, PEng, Au Gold's exploration manager, supervised the preparation of the technical information.
- Consideration: Specific purchase price or consideration terms were not disclosed in this release. (Refer to the company's Jan. 15, 2026 press release for full agreement details.)
